    Hi
    Even I was facing almost the same kind of problem. But in my case it was wired clients to the workgroup bridge 350.
    I had done lot of testings and reading at that time to resolve this problem.
    However in your case I feel your problem can be resolved by keeping the option "Reliable multicast for Workgroup bridges" disabled in the APs under dot11radio interface settings. This is possibly because the radios cannot associate to more than 20 clients at a time if the option is in the enable mode.
    You need to keep this option enabled in a root bridge when you have problems of dropping the wired clients to the workgroup bridge.
    By keeping this option enabled, you are actually asking the Root bridges to consider the Workgroup bridges as Infrastructure devices and not as clients thereby making the roots to send all the multicasts to the WGBs. However in that case it losses the efficiency of associating more than 20 clients.

    Hi Jeffrey,
    Reverting the Access Point Back to Autonomous Mode
    Have a look at Step 3
    http://www.cisco.com/en/US/products/hw/wireless/ps430/prod_technical_reference09186a00804fc3dc.html#wp161272
    You can convert an access point from lightweight mode back to autonomous mode by loading a Cisco IOS Release that supports autonomous mode (Cisco IOS release 12.3(7)JA or earlier). If the access point is associated to a controller, you can use the controller to load the Cisco IOS release. If the access point is not associated to a controller, you can load the Cisco IOS release using TFTP.
    Using a TFTP Server to Return to a Previous Release
    Follow these steps to revert from LWAPP mode to autonomous mode by loading a Cisco IOS release using a TFTP server:
    Step 1 The static IP address of the PC on which your TFTP server software runs should be between 10.0.0.2 and 10.0.0.30.
    Step 2 Make sure that the PC contains the access point image file (such as c1200-k9w7-tar.122-15.JA.tar for a 1200 series access point) in the TFTP server folder and that the TFTP server is activated.
    Step 3 Rename the access point image file in the TFTP server folder to c1200-k9w7-tar.default for a 1200 series access point, c1130-k9w7-tar.default for an 1130 series access point, and c1240-k9w7-tar.default for a 1240 series access point.
    Step 4 Connect the PC to the access point using a Category 5 (CAT5) Ethernet cable.
    Step 5 Disconnect power from the access point.
    Step 6 Press and hold MODE while you reconnect power to the access point.
    Step 7 Hold the MODE button until the status LED turns red (approximately 20 to 30 seconds) and then release.
    Step 8 Wait until the access point reboots, as indicated by all LEDs turning green followed by the Status LED blinking green.
    Step 9 After the access point reboots, reconfigure it using the GUI or the CLI.

    You are missing a huge conceptual point. If the file can not spool off of the hard drive fast enough, you get dropped frames. It isn't a processor or ram issue right now, it is a hard drive speed issue. Your system drive is overtaxed trying to run OSX, applications AND spool video. It just can't keep up. Changing the graphic card isn't going to help (and how do you change the card in a laptop?)
    Get an external esata drive - with the new MacBookPro you'll need an esata Expresscard34 adapter for the computer to connect the drive. Firewire is not an option with that machine and USB2 will not cut it with high data rate formats like ProRes.
    When you drop in the ProRes clip to the timeline and it tells you there is a mismatch, this means your preset for the timeline is something other than your clip. You WANT ProRes and you need the sequence to match your clip - tell the program to CHANGE the sequence to match the clip.
